From The Ground

exceptional new project from two musical forces of the Scottish folk and roots music scene.

Laura-Beth Salter (Kinnaris Quintet, The Shee) and Ali Hutton (Ross Ainslie & Ali Hutton, Treacherous Orchestra) have come together to create a Scottish soundscaping masterpiece with a powerful message at its core.

Cinematic, contemporary and captivating, whilst still drawing from traditional roots, From the Ground is an ode to nature and its infinite power to heal. It carries an urgent message for its listeners – we must cherish our planet – and celebrates how connecting with our natural environment can benefit our mental health.

After  launching their debut gig with 7 piece band at a headline show at Celtic Connections 2025, Ali and Laura-Beth are now taking their new music to audiences all over the UK with the option of a smaller line-up to enable them to visit intimate venues. The four piece line-up will play music from the album, as well as new newly composed pieces and will feature Patsy Reid on fiddle and Owen Sincalir on guitar. Some shows will also feature spoken word by renowned poet Jim C. Mackintosh.
